Ingredients

7 servings
  • 2 lbs 93/7 Ground Beef

    Extra-lean ground beef (96% lean / 4% fat). Walmart carries Great Value 96/4.

  • 8 oz Turkey Breakfast Sausage

    Lean turkey breakfast sausage. Jennie-O or Jimmy Dean Turkey are common.

  • 200 g Celery
  • 200 g Yellow Onion
  • 200 g Bell Pepper
  • 130 g Fat-Free Cheddar Cheese
  • 2 Velveeta, Original(38g)

    Velveeta original block (not slices). Found near canned soups, not refrigerated.

  • 18 oz Low Sodium Beef Broth
  • 2 can Tomato
  • 12 g Garlic
  • 250 g Rice, Brown, Long-Grain
  • 2 g Red pepper flakes
  • 1 Cayenne Pepper, Ground(7g)

Instructions

  1. 1Add 2 lbs beef and 8 oz lean turkey sausage to the skillet
  2. 2Season with chili flakes, paprika, pepper, salt, and cayenne
  3. 3Add 200g chopped celery
  4. 4Add 200g white chopped onions
  5. 5Add 200g mixed chopped peppers
  6. 6Add 18 ounces bone broth
  7. 7Add 2 cans no salt tomatoes
  8. 8Let cook
  9. 9Cook 250g brown rice (weighed raw) in a rice cooker separately
  10. 10Add cooked rice to the mixture
  11. 11Disperse evenly into 7 meal prep containers
  12. 12Weigh each container to ensure equal portions
